Learning effects occur when mistakes are made and then new solutions found. insights gained by employees enhance their work perf

ormance. economies of scare are present. companies take advantage of experience curve efficiencies.
Business
1 answer:
Alexxandr [17]3 years ago
7 0
Learning effects occur when insights gained by employees enhance their work performance. Learning effects refer to the process by which knowledge or experience increases productivity and results in higher salaries. By gaining insights into how something can be done better and more efficiently, workers can increase their productivity and earn more wages simultaneously.

Jack works hard on his projects as his manager promises him a salary increase on successful completion of the project. jack's ha
DIA [1.3K]

Extrinsic motivation

 Extrinsic motivation is defined as behavior that is motivated by external factors outside an individual such as rewards, fame, attention or praise. Therefore, if Jack’s motivation for successfully completing a project is a salary raise and more, he is externally motivated. He is motivated to do well largely by the external factor, money, rather than intrinsic factors such as a sense of achievement and pride.
